Live Music: Jinx JonesQuick View

Denver native Jinx Jones got his start in music early and relocated to the Bay Area in 1989. His guitar artistry landed him work with legendary artists including Chuck Berry, Roy Buchanan and Solomon Burke. Underscoring his pan-genre fluidity, he played bass on En Vogue’s 1992’s smash hit “Free Your Mind.” Back in the rock idiom, he launched the Kingtones; Jones has released five albums that draw upon rockabilly, swing and surf: License to Twang, Rumble & Twang, Rip and Run, Live Twang in Finland and Twang-Tastic! His 2021 album, Blue Gardenia, showcased Jones’ versatility via his command of jazz stylings.

Judgment of Paris: The Grand Tasting

Taste Napa's Judgment of Paris victory! 50+ premier wines, gourmet stations, French American flea market, live entertainment, and much more!

Fifty years ago, Napa Valley shocked the world. In 1976, a blind tasting in Paris put American winemaking on the global map, forever changing the course of wine history. Now, half a century later, we invite you to raise a glass to the legends, the pioneers, and the future of wine.

Maria Manetti La Dolce Vita! honoring Luciano Pavarotti

Experience the enchantment of La Dolce Vita at this special evening dedicated to the artistic legacy of Luciano Pavarotti, one of the world's most celebrated tenors and cultural ambassadors.
The evening begins at Charles Krug Winery, where Festival Napa Valley pays tribute to Pavarotti's extraordinary impact on opera and his lasting influence on generations of singers and audiences.
This symphonic program highlights his enduring legacy. Festival Napa Valley alumna Michelle Di Russo, recipient of the 2022 Joel Revzen Conducting Prize, leads the winners of the 2026 Luciano Pavarotti International Voice Competition – presenting a new generation of artists shaped by the standards he set.

Napa9

Napa9 is an epic one-day adventure that traverses nine peaks throughout Napa Valley consisting of 13,500 feet of climbing and 125 miles. Not for the faint of heart, the Napa9 serves as a fundraiser for the Napa Police Youth Services Bureau.
